The Classic 1981 highly original, daring work, covering a wide array of disparate material such as: technical manuals, gynecology texts, early theologians statements, annals of American exploration, office manuals, poetry, dreams, etc. A book that explores ritual, science, history and imagination calling upon memory and mutilation and female anger, a very moving book. enacted). The woman who is raped is often accused of perjury in a courtroom. Her word is not believed. Moreover, part of the defense of a man accused of rape has been to accuse a woman of being a "whore," of being licentious or amoral. Even a woman who has been raped but who has not gone through a rape trial feels ashamed of what has happened to her, as if this violence against her revealed something of her own nature. act.
